Accomplishments I Made at Ivy Creek Elementary School

Ivy Creek Elementary School

Three to four times a week I came to Ivy Creek Elementary School and interned in the Media Center.  My mentor Miss Sharp taught me how to catalogue, cover, and log books.  This year I have re-organized the entire book room, read to students, re-did the fiction section in the Media Center, and performed many "mini" projects along the way.  In the Media Center, I know that I have made a difference to the Gwinnett County School System because if it weren't for me, many projects would still not be done.  With a new book room, kids are able to find books easier and volunteers are able to shelf the books back more efficiently.  With a new fiction section, kids are able to search more specifically with books they desire to read.  Seeing the difference I was able to make these past few months at Ivy Creek Elementary School gives me hope that I will be able to make a difference in this world in my future.
